1. Total Injector Volume to Dispense and Charge
a. Add together the total number of injectors in
the system.
b. From Table 1 or Table 2, find the Injector Type
in the first column and the related Injector Vol-
ume to Charge in the third column. Multiply this
value by the total number of injectors deter-
mined in Step a.
2. Calculate the volume of lubricant in the Pipeline (G):
a. Use the pipe's inside diameter (ID) measure-
ment to calculate the area of the pipe.
b. Measure the length of the pipe (G) only. Do not
include the feeder lines (S) in this calculation.
c. Multiply the area of the pipe calculated in
Step a by the length of the pipe measured in
Step b.

3. Calculate line expansion and fluid compression in
the pipe using the 10% Rule - multiply the volume
calculated in Step 2 by 10%.
4. Calculate the Total System Volume required.
a. Add together the total from Step 1 and Step 3
only. Do not include Step 2.
b. The Total System Volume required must be
less than the Pump Lubricant Output / Stroke
provided in the fourth column of Table 1 or
Table 2.
c. If the Total System Volume required is greater
than the Pump Lubricant Output / Stroke pro-
vided in the fourth column of Table 1 or Table 2,
split the system into two or more systems.
